UNC wide receiver Tez Walker, a preseason first team All-ACC honoree and member of the Biletnikoff Award watch list, has had his waiver appeal for immediate eligibility denied by the NCAA. This means Walker will not be eligible to play in 2023, though UNC is appealing the decision. Walker’s college journey has had several twists and turns. He originally accepted an offer to play football at East Tennessee State in 2019, but the offer was deferred after Walker suffered a knee injury and he never enrolled.
